Some cleanups from NetBSD:
- C99 initializers. - Change the default volume label from "NO NAME" to "NO_NAME". - Set OEM String to "BSD4.4 " following the unnamed spacing convention in that other OS that suggests "MSWIN4.1" Also, David Naylor's changes for Clang, mostly changing the signess of constants. Submitted by: Pedro F. Giffuni <giffunip tutopia com> Clang fixes by: David Naylor <naylor.b.david gmail com> Reviewed by: bde (with some disagreement about Clang issues) MFC after: 2 weeks
